🚆 Amtrak High-Speed Rail (HSR) Routes Visualization Tool

This Python script generates a visualization of the planned Amtrak High-Speed Rail (HSR) routes in the United States.

alt text

Based on the data provided by Amtrak, the script generates a plot of the planned HSR routes in the United States. The plot is interactive and can be zoomed in and out. The plot is also viewable as an HTML file.

Installation

  1. Clone this repository: git clone https://github.com/asharahmed/amtrak-hsr-routes.git
  2. Navigate to the project directory: cd amtrak-hsr-routes
  3. Install the required dependencies: pip install -r requirements.txt

Usage

  1. Ensure you have Python 3.x installed.
  2. Navigate to the project directory: cd amtrak-hsr-routes
  3. Run the script: python main.py
  4. The plot will be displayed in a new browser window.
